The College is pleased to announce the appointment of Lorraine Tulloch as Programme Lead for a new Unit, hosted in Glasgow on behalf of the Academy of Medical Royal Colleges and Faculties. Core funded by the Scottish Government, the Unit aims to inform and influence public health, eventually to reduce the number of Scots who are overweight by delivering leadership through health professionals in order to achieve a reduction in the proportion of people in Scotland whose health is threatened by obesity.
Lorraine Tulloch will begin to bring the work of the Unit together from June 2015, assisted by an Advisory Board appointed by the College. The Unit’s working title describes its sphere of interest although it is likely to change, and there will be a further announcement of the Unit’s title and draft programme in the autumn.
